A Reflex Challenge Awaits in Jump Duck
In Jump Duck, players are thrown into a world of frantic reflex-testing action. As a player, your goal is simple yet challenging: jump and duck to dodge incoming shots. This modern remake of the Xbox 360 indie title offers an addictive gameplay loop that will keep your heart racing. With influences drawn from Twisted System of Fuzion Frenzy, prepare for an exhilarating ride that hones your timing and coordination skills.
Classic Mechanics with a Fresh Spin
The core mechanics of Jump Duck are deceptively straightforward. Players time their movements to avoid a barrage of incoming shots. Each session ramps up the intensity, demanding split-second decisions and precise actions. As the difficulty scales, only the fastest and most focused players will prevail. This straightforward yet engaging gameplay is what makes the title so appealing to fans of the action arcade genre.
